Inspections
Test Limited Drive Speed - Standard Base
Models
36 Press down the foot switch.
37 Raise the primary boom approximately
2 feet / 61 cm.
38 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the primary boom raised should not exceed
1 foot / 30 cm per second.
39 Lower the primary boom to the stowed position.
40 Raise the secondary boom approximately
2 feet / 61 cm.
41 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the secondary boom raised should not
exceed 1 foot / 30 cm per second.
42 Lower the secondary boom to the stowed
position.
43 Extend the primary boom approximately
1 foot / 30 cm.
44 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the primary boom extended should not
exceed 1 foot / 30 cm per second.
45 Retract the boom to the stowed position.
If the drive speed with the primary boom raised, the
secondary boom raised or the primary boom
extended exceeds 1 foot / 30 cm per second,
immediately tag and remove the machine from
service.
Test Limited Drive Speed - Narrow Base Models
36 Press down the foot switch.
37 Raise the primary boom approximately
2 feet / 61 cm.
38 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the primary boom raised should not exceed
6 in / 15 cm per second.
39 Lower the primary boom to the stowed position.
40 Raise the secondary boom approximately
2 feet / 61 cm.
41 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the secondary boom raised should not
exceed 6 in / 15 cm per second.
42 Lower the secondary boom to the stowed
position.
43 Extend the primary boom approximately
1 foot / 30 cm.
44 Slowly move the drive control handle to the full
drive position.
Result: The maximum achievable drive speed
with the primary boom extended should not
exceed 6 in / 15 cm per second.
45 Retract the boom to the stowed position.
If the drive speed with the primary boom raised, the
secondary boom raised or the primary boom
extended exceeds 6 in / 15 cm per second,
immediately tag and remove the machine from
service.
